The design principle

A language model can generate a reply. It cannot create a relationship by itself.

A foundation model can reason, interpret language and produce convincing conversation. Left alone, however, it does not naturally remain annoyed, slowly build trust, distinguish attraction from safety or remember a promise and return days later to ask whether it was kept.

Those behaviours require systems beyond language generation. That is what we built.

Aimee’s neuroanatomical terminology is descriptive. It reflects a nature-inspired software architecture and is not a claim of biological consciousness.

Relationship Behaviour Engine

Human relationships do not develop along a single line.

Trust, attraction, safety and frustration are related, but they are not the same thing. Aimee represents them independently.

She can feel chemistry without feeling safe.

Aimee may flirt with someone while refusing to become more vulnerable. She can care deeply and still remain annoyed after an argument. She can forgive without instantly forgetting.

These distinctions produce emotional consequence. Aimee does not reset to cheerful compliance after every turn.

The relationship develops a shape, not merely a score.
Excitement Rises quickly and settles quickly.
Irritation Fades gradually across later interactions.
Trust Moves slowly and requires consistency.

Memory that evolves

Memory is not a transcript.

Aimee stores significance, not merely text. Her memory has domains, emotional weight and a lifecycle.

The Hippocampal Memory System

Aimee distinguishes lasting knowledge from temporary context. This allows a difficult week to matter now without defining the user forever.

Personal factsPersistent
PreferencesWeighted
Life eventsConsolidated
Current contextVolatile
Relationship momentsEmotional

The REM Sleep Cycle

Once each day, weak temporary memories may fade while emotionally significant material becomes more stable. Memory stays useful rather than becoming an endless landfill of conversation.
